Caol Ila Distillery
- Distillery: Caol Ila Distillery
- Location: Port Askaig, Isle of Islay, Scotland
- Founded: 1846
- Owner: Diageo
- Special feature:
- Iconic Islay single malt, known for its peaty smoke and maritime notes
- Style: smoky, salty, slightly fruity, more accessible than Laphroaig or Ardbeg
- Key ingredient in many Johnnie Walker blends, but also available as a single malt
- Produces various bottlings: core range, distillery-only releases and limited editions
💡 Fun fact: Caol Ila means ‘Sound of Islay’ in Gaelic and the distillery is strategically situated overlooking the narrow channel between Islay and the Scottish mainland, which contributes to the whisky’s maritime character.
